WebFluorite is also a gemstone with various colors mixed. Green and purple, blue and purple, yellow and purple, or purple and clear, you can enjoy many kinds of combinations. It would be fun to collect different color combinations. The one with mixed color is also circulating in the name of Rainbow Fluorite.
